Welcome to your strange, short week. Fourth of July approacheth. But you have a few days to slog through first.

The Highland Park Film Festival, part of the town’s centennial celebration, offers a screening of Yankee Doodle Dandy, just to prime the pump for Thursday. The 1940s classic is a biographical musical about the life of Broadway star George M. Cohan, proving once and for all that real Americans love show tunes.

Also this evening, Rachael Yamagata will help you express your excess emotion with a show at Sons of Hermann Hall. Tickets are $20, and still available online. Sanders Bohlke supports. Post show options include the Double Wide and Black Swan Saloon.
